Tolerate Trump? Tolerate hate.

If Trump were a German or French or English politician, Americans would be soiling themselves with fears of Neo-Nazi parties. Incredible editorials would spread alarming images of anti-immigrant thuggery. The openly announced racism would bring down walls of criticism about evil, backward Europe.

Instead, we merely shake our heads, either laugh at his narcissism or decry his hypocrisy. He's an obnoxious, spoiled child to us. We tolerate this because he is "one of us." Not be taken seriously. No real American can be so hateful and so popular.

Wrong. Guess again. American history is filled with hateful people who clamber to the top, representing those who would deny success to others. We may not have a Nazi-type ideology at work here in the U.S., but we have deeply rooted racism. We still harbor fears about those with the "wrong" religion.

Tolerate Trump? Tolerate hate. It *is* that simple.
